Illinois State Public Links ChampionshipThe Illinois State Public Links Championship was held annually by the Chicago District Golf Association from 1992-2014. The first championship was held in 1992 and the winner was Jeff Matheson. In 2001, the format was changed from an 18-hole championship to a 36-hole championship. All competitors played 18 holes the first day with the low 20 and ties advancing to the final day. The champion of this tournament was the recipient of the Joe Jemsek Trophy.
